Publisher's Synopsis

Progressive Lessons in German is a language learning book written by Rudolph W. Huebsch and originally published in 1911. The book is designed to teach German to beginners in a progressive and systematic manner. It is divided into 40 lessons, each of which introduces new vocabulary, grammar rules, and exercises to reinforce the concepts learned. The lessons cover topics such as greetings, introductions, numbers, time, weather, food, clothing, and travel. The book also includes a comprehensive vocabulary list and a German-English dictionary at the end.
